A termination of parental rights (TPR) is:

A. a judicial declaration that ends the legal relationship between parent and child when this is in the best interests of the child.
B. granted if TPR is in the best interests of the child.
C. granted involuntarily if the parent is unfit.
D. all of the above.


Answer: D
